With just a look at Priyanka’s upcoming movie, Mary Kom’s, first look one can confidently say that she has successfully broken her own limitations and depicted herself in a way that has never been done before in Indian cinema. The usually glamorous and sexy actress has donned a ‘closer to the life’ look for the movie in an effort to portray Mary Kom’s character in its full honesty.
She didn’t shy away for even a second from stripping herself off her typical diva image.The movie is director Omung Kumar’s brain child and has received backing from Sanjay Leela Bhansali. It’s a biopic based on five time world champion boxer Mary Kom and takes the audience through her journey of defying the conventions and following her true calling. PeeCee was undoubtedly the right choice to become the face of this story because she has a successful history of carrying off unconventional roles with an ease. Whether it was Vishal Bhardwaj’s 7 Khoon Maaf or Anurag Basu’s Barfi, Priyanka exemplified courage and brilliance in every offbeat role that she took up.
She herself proclaimed that portraying Mary Kom wasn’t a difficult task for her because she could relate to her story very well. She said that just like Mary she also came from a small town and took the world by surprise with her dedication towards making her dream come true. She called herself a rebel, rebel without a cause, which is one word that can be used to exactly define Mary.
